我有一个标题,我需要在打印在动态 Excel 表上的每一页上设置它。
有什么方法可以获取页码吗?
根据swamy 的评论,解决方案是HSSFHeader
从HSSFSheet
HSSFHeader header = sheet.getHeader();
然后您可以设置左、中、右文本,包括字体、字体样式、字体大小、页码、日期、时间等。
例子
header.setCenter(HSSFHeader.font("Calibri", "regular") +
HSSFHeader.fontSize((short) 14) + "My " + HSSFHeader.startBold() + "Styled" +
HSSFHeader.endBold() + " Text with page number " + HSSFHeader.page());
结果